外贸网

  • 首页
  • 关于java程序员应聘机试 JAVA面试的时候一般考什么

    作者:媒体   更新日期:2024.05.19
    我是刚找到了一个java程序员的工作,现在我告诉你一些具体的问题;
    他们首先回让你自我介绍1-3分钟,这其中,可能你就要谈到,你对java的了解吧。然后问你曾经做过那些关于java的项目(或者自己编写),他们会问你对bean是否了解,然后会问,你对j2ee了解多少,问这个的目的,对数是想问你,对ejb有多少了解,然后会问你对应用服务器,比如weblogic和websphere了解多少。因为你面试的是java程序员,还可能让你做一份java人证的考试题(1-20道),最后可能会问你关于数据库的知识在最后,可能就是问你的薪资方面的要求了。
    就这些了,这是我面试所经历的一切。

    如果是初级,一般给你出一些可以应用java基础知识来解决的程序问题,不会太难,很多都会考一些字符串的处理和io操作,主要考察你的逻辑思维能力,只要你认真复习,很容易过的。
    ssh机试当中主要让你运用配置文件搭起一个可执行基本功能流程的架子,然后写一个数据库操作的功能,例如:写一个映射类,实现它的dao和service,然后通过控制层将此类的一些业务功能展现出来,数据库操作可以是对一个表的增、删、查、改。

    主要还是看你应聘的公司运用什么样的技术

    这样的话 我建议你看下编程思想 看看几种排序 查询的方法如何写的
    再就是你所说的IO 线程 继承 接口 如果可行的话 再看几种常见的设计模式 如工厂模式 单例等 我想也就无非这些东西了

    JAVA面试的时候一般考什么

    Java程序员应聘一般要经过笔试和面试。作为一个技术人员,特别是刚出道的,笔试的成绩是比较重要。以下是我经过几次笔试总结的一些经验教训。

    一般来说,试题会分为三个部分,Java基础、数据库基础和综合题。

    首先是Java基础,这个很简单,也就是考考你对Java语言本身的理解,包括语法,类库的使用等。有选择题,也会有写代码题。写代码的时候认真仔细就是了。基础题答案一般都比较死,所以尽量不要错。在这,出一道我遇到的题考考大家,Java编程:把American,Japan,China,France,Brazil按英文字母排序。说说思路就行了:)

    其次是数据库。准确的说,考的不是数据库,而是SQL语句。一般题型是,给两三个表,然后让你根据需求写SQL。最普通的就是学生表、选课表和成绩表。要掌握的就是连接查询,还有就是一些函数(建表、表操作等就不说了哈)。其实这些都相当简单,但是往往被新手忽略。我就遭过,因为有半年没写过SQL了,连接查询搞忘完了,有两次笔试都空起,结果可想而知。这些是必备技术,千万不能空起啊!

    然后是综合题。之所以说是综合题,是因为包含的内容比较多,一般都是主观题。这里,人家是想看看你对Java高级技术以及周边技术的了解程度和运用能力,说白了,就是考概念和考应用题。这里说的Java高级技术,也就是J2EE架构中的技术,这些不会的话,人家是不得要你的。如果你会一些流行的技术框架,那就更好了。所谓Java周边技术,包括HTTP,HTML,XML,UML,JavaScript,CSS等,要求一般不是很高,要了解,比如让你用HTML写个表单你要会。关于刚才提到的技术或者框架,希望要了解其工作的原理和机制,一般要考,比如让你说说Struts的MVC。关于应用题,可能出一道网络应用来考。

    以上就是我笔试的经验,一般是这样,不过我也遇到过变态的。一次笔试,就被彻底甩翻,C/C++、数据库、Java技术、Shell编程、网络协议、Unix、软件工程全部上了。

    如果笔试做的好,那就成功大半了,不过不要轻视面试哦!

    关于面试技巧,网上太多了,我就不多说。作为技术人员,虽说以技术为主,但沟通能力同样重要,面试时要主动,表达要清楚,要微笑,要诚实,要稳重。

    关于价钱,说实话,我们中国的程序员是世界上最好的程序员,我们拿最少的钱,干最多的活。刚出道的程序员,在成都,一般来说,试用不会超过2000,多半是1500左右,做好被资本家剥削的心理准备吧

    我来分享一下吧,我的学历是专科,但是我最近一次的跳槽,是进的外企,并且是那个行业里面的老大。其实呢,我个人觉得,java这东西入门容易,可是想要学的透,学的精点,还挺难的。面试的时候,你应该把你擅长的方面给面试官凸显出来。 1.让面试官跟着你走,你要善于引导面试官往你会的方面问问题。比如。原本面试官问了arraylist和linkedlist之间的区别。如果你对这块了解的透彻的话,应该知道这和数据结构有关系,如果你的数据结构很好的话,你在说区别的时候,尽量的说些数据结构相关的知识,以及引升出相关的知识(你熟悉的)。这样面试官的思路会被你引到你的知识面上来 2.尽量表现你在某方面的特长,java的相关知识很广,你不可能将每个方面学的都很透彻,但是如果遇到你精通的题目,尽量阐述清晰、透彻,并引出你自己的个人见解。 3.不会的问题,没关系。正如第二点,每个人有善长的一面,可能面试你的人善长的不是你善长的,如果不会,要调整心态,要用你现有的知识原理去推导面试官的问题,并且申明这是你的推导,如果对则最好,如果不对,向面试官虚心讨教。其实面试也是个成长的过程,说不定这次的学习,在下次的面试中起到至关的作用 4.拖延时间。前几轮的面试时间正常都不会太长,使用前面的注意点,把自己的有点表现出来,同时拖时间,面试官没有更多的时间去问问题。 5.谦逊点。很重要!

    Java编程常见面试题目,要求正确答案?
    答:另外,断言不应该以任何方式改变程序的状态。 第八,GC是什么? 为什么要有GC? (基础)。 GC是垃圾收集器。Java 程序员不用担心内存管理,因为垃圾收集器会自动进行管理。要请求垃圾收集,可以调用下面的方法之一: System.gc() Runtime.getRuntime().gc() 第九,String s = new String("xyz");创建了几个...

    谁有JAVA程序员面试的程序题啊?
    答:我是一个即将毕业的学生,去面试,谁能给我点JAVA基础方面的程序题呢?就是那种给你个程序,然后给出几个答案的选择题... 我是一个即将毕业的学生,去面试,谁能给我点JAVA基础方面的程序题呢?就是那种给你个程序,然后给出几个答案的选择题 展开  我来答 ...

    应届生面试Java相关岗位可能会被问到哪些技术问题
    答:Java被设计成允许应用程序可以运行在任意的平台,而不需要程序员为每一个平台单独重写或者是重新编译。Java虚拟机让这个变为可能,因为它知道底层硬件平台的指令长度和其他特性。2.JDK和JRE的区别是什么?Java运行时环境(JRE)是将要执行Java程序的Java虚拟机。它同时也包含了执行applet需要的浏览器插件。Java...

    程序员面试有哪些技巧?
    答:不管你是职场老手还是菜鸟,掌握Java程序员面试的技巧是很有必要的,今天跟随沙河IT培训一起来了解一下。Java程序员面试时该有的技巧 一份专业简历很重要 在这里小编给你的建议是:如果你想提高自己的入选机会,那最好还是花点心思制作一份专业的简历,相较于你将来可能得到的巨大收获,这一点时间还是...

    JAVA面试题?
    答:一.历史原因:Hashtable是基于陈旧的Dictionary类的,HashMap是Java 1.2引进的Map接口的一个实现 二.同步性:Hashtable是线程安全的,也就是说是同步的,而HashMap是线程序不安全的,不是同步的 三.值:只有HashMap可以让你将空值作为一个表的条目的key或value 28、char型变量中能不能存贮一个中文...

    java程序员面试
    答:Collections是个java.util下的类,它包含有各种有关集合操作的静态方法。 Collection是个java.util下的...Java 程序员不用担心内存管理,因为垃圾收集器会自动进行管理。要请求垃圾收集,可以调用下面的方法之一:...启动一个线程是调用start()方法,使线程所代表的虚拟处理机处于可运行状态,这意味着它可以由JVM调度并...

    java程序员面试技巧有哪些
    答:1、最主要的就是简历,你的简历一定要全面,做过的项目,项目中运用过哪些技术。都要写出来,方便面试官了解你 2、面试前多看看java的面试基础题,有些面试官会问一些基础。3、面试时不要慌,要有自信。4、其次就时着装了,尽量穿的不要太过休闲 ...

    java面试会问什么
    答:Java 程序员不用担心内存管理,因为垃圾收集器会自动进行管理。要请求垃圾收集,可以调用下面的方法之一:System.gc()Runtime.getRuntime().gc()第九,String s = new String("xyz");创建了几个String Object?两个对象,一个是“xyx”,一个是指向“xyx”的引用对象s。第十,Math.round(11.5)等於多少? Math....

    JAVA程序员 面试题目
    答:错误的地方:一、4和5行,超出了byte类型的范围(-128~127);二、全局整型变量x,y在声明时没有声明为static导致18,20,22行中用到变量x和y的地方都错了。不能在static块中引用非static成员。三、check方法上可能看得出是返回一个boolean类型的变量,但是在程序中返回操作都放在了if语句块中,那么...

    如果你是一个 Java 面试官,你会问哪些问题?
    答:对于我们日常工作应用较多的类库,面试前可以系统化总结一下,有助于临场发挥。2、对比Hashtable、HashMap、TreeMap有什么不同?考点分析:上面的回答,只是对一些基本特征的简单总结,针对Map相关可以扩展的问题很多,从各种数据结构、典型应用场景,到程序设计实现的技术考量,尤其是在Java 8里,HashMap本身...